What is Mitchell Machine?
Mitchell Machine is a third-generation family business with over fifty years of experience in building specialized custom machinery. Founded in the 1920s by John A. Mitchell, the company initially focused on part production before transitioning into the tool and die business under the leadership of his sons. Currently owned and managed by Jack and Frank Mitchell, the company now emphasizes special machinery and sub-contract machining. Leveraging modern equipment and advanced CAD/CAM systems, Mitchell Machine efficiently produces complex parts of varying sizes. The establishment of Mitchell Engineering, Inc. in 1992 further broadened its service offerings, enabling the design and construction of sophisticated custom machines through a talented team of engineers and technicians. The company's 30,000 square-foot facility supports on-site fabrication, assembly, and pre-shipment testing, ensuring high standards for longevity and reliability in its automated machinery.
